🚀 Singularis × Industrial++ 2025 25 сентября в Москве пройдёт Industrial++ 2025 — конференция для разработчиков и управленцев в промышленности. От Сингуляриса доклад подготовили CEO Дмитрий Крыжановский и CV Leading Engineer Александр Катаев. Тема выступления: «Как сшивать большие изображения – от медицины до ветрогенераторов». Страница доклада на сайте конференции: 🔗 https://industrialconf.ru/2025/abstracts/1583
